  • The Jake McCoy franchise is a series of films all starring Tom Selleck as the titular character, Professor Jacob "Jake" McCoy, an archaeology professor at fictional Merrill University in the late 1930's, who is in fact also a daring adventurer known for traveling the world to hunt down renowned and mysterious artifacts. The character first appeared in the 1982 film Raiders of the Lost Ark, and was followed by five sequels, all of which have starred Selleck in the lead role. The character of McCoy is a throwback to pulp heroes from the 1930's and 40's. Producer George Lucas, of Star Wars fame, chose not to set McCoy in the Anarchy due to its negative perceptions and the "monopoly that fellow with a shotgun has on that time period." McCoy has numerous trademarks beyond his wisdom of ancient artifacts - his fedora, bullwhip, humorous charm and fear of snakes.
